首页 / 服务器资讯 / 正文
高性能缓存服务器,提升系统效能的关键利器,高性能缓存服务器有哪些

Time:2025年02月08日 Read:9 评论:42 作者:y21dr45

在当今数字化时代,数据呈爆炸式增长,各类应用程序与服务面临着海量请求的挑战,无论是社交媒体平台、在线购物网站还是云服务提供商,都需要快速响应用户请求,以提供流畅的用户体验并维持业务竞争力,而高性能缓存服务器,正是在这一背景下脱颖而出,成为优化系统性能、减轻后端数据库压力的重要技术手段。

高性能缓存服务器,提升系统效能的关键利器,高性能缓存服务器有哪些

一、高性能缓存服务器的原理与架构

高性能缓存服务器基于内存存储数据的特性,相较于传统的磁盘存储,其读写速度呈指数级提升,它位于应用程序与数据库之间,当应用程序发起数据请求时,首先会查询缓存服务器,如果所需数据已存在于缓存中(缓存命中),则直接从缓存中获取并返回给应用程序,这一过程几乎可以瞬间完成,大大缩短了响应时间,若缓存未命中,即缓存中没有相应数据,缓存服务器则会代表应用程序向后端数据库发起请求,获取数据后一方面将数据返回给应用程序,另一方面会将该数据按照特定的算法和策略存入缓存,以便后续相同或相似的请求能够直接从缓存中读取,减少对数据库的重复访问。

从架构上看,高性能缓存服务器通常采用分布式集群的方式部署,通过将多个缓存节点组成一个集群,不仅可以实现数据的冗余备份,提高系统的可靠性和可用性,还能根据实际需求灵活扩展缓存容量和处理能力,一些流行的缓存服务器软件如 Redis 和 Memcached,都支持主从复制和哨兵机制,确保在部分节点故障时,整个缓存服务仍能正常运行,并且数据不会丢失,分布式架构也便于根据业务的地域分布和流量特点,将缓存节点部署在不同的地理位置,进一步降低网络延迟,提升整体性能。

二、高性能缓存服务器的优势

1、显著提升系统响应速度

对于大多数互联网应用而言,用户等待时间过长往往会导致大量流失,高性能缓存服务器能够将原本需要数秒甚至数十秒才能完成的数据库查询操作,缩短至毫秒级甚至微秒级,以一个电商网站为例,在促销活动期间,大量用户同时浏览商品详情页,如果每次请求都直接查询数据库,数据库可能会因不堪重负而出现响应缓慢甚至卡顿的情况,而引入缓存服务器后,商品的基本信息、库存状态等常用数据可以被缓存起来,用户再次访问时可直接从缓存中获取,页面加载速度大幅提升,用户体验得到极大改善。

2、有效减轻后端数据库压力

数据库作为系统的核心数据存储和管理组件,其性能瓶颈往往制约着整个系统的扩展性,通过缓存服务器分担大部分的读请求,数据库的负载得以大幅降低,从而有更多的资源和精力去处理写操作以及复杂的数据分析任务,一个社交平台每天会产生大量的点赞、评论等互动数据,这些数据需要写入数据库进行持久化存储,如果没有缓存服务器,大量的用户信息查询请求也会涌向数据库,导致数据库的 CPU 和 I/O 资源被大量占用,影响数据写入和整体性能,而有了缓存服务器后,数据库的压力得到有效缓解,系统的稳定性和可扩展性得到增强。

3、降低系统运营成本

在硬件成本方面,由于缓存服务器可以有效减少对高性能数据库服务器的配置要求,企业无需为了应对高并发读请求而过度购置昂贵的数据库硬件设备,在能源消耗和运维人力成本上,缓存服务器相对简单高效的架构也使得其在运行过程中所需的能耗更低,且维护管理更为便捷,相比于不断升级数据库服务器硬件来满足日益增长的性能需求,定期对缓存服务器集群进行扩容和优化的成本要低得多,而且可以通过自动化脚本和监控工具更方便地进行日常运维工作。

三、高性能缓存服务器的应用场景

1、Web 应用开发

在各类 Web 应用中,无论是动态网页的内容展示还是用户登录认证等功能,都广泛依赖于缓存服务器,新闻资讯类网站会将热门文章的内容缓存起来,当用户点击阅读时能够快速呈现页面;博客平台则会缓存用户的个人资料和文章列表等信息,减少数据库查询次数,提高页面加载速度。

2、电子商务领域

电商平台的商品信息展示、购物车功能以及订单查询等环节都离不开缓存服务器的支持,通过对商品图片、价格、规格等数据的缓存,用户可以更流畅地浏览商品并进行购物操作,同时也有助于商家在促销活动期间应对海量流量冲击,确保交易流程的顺畅进行。

3、游戏行业

在线游戏中,玩家的游戏角色属性、装备信息、游戏场景数据等都需要频繁读取和更新,高性能缓存服务器可以将这些数据缓存在内存中,使玩家在游戏过程中能够快速获取所需信息,减少因数据传输延迟而导致的卡顿现象,提升游戏的流畅度和趣味性。

4、大数据分析与处理

在大数据分析过程中,经常需要对海量数据进行重复查询和计算,利用缓存服务器缓存中间结果数据,可以避免重复计算相同数据集,提高数据分析的效率和速度,在金融风险评估模型的构建中,对于历史交易数据的统计分析结果可以先缓存起来,为后续的风险预测和决策提供快速的数据支持。

四、面临的挑战与应对策略

尽管高性能缓存服务器具有诸多优势,但在实际应用中也面临一些挑战,首先是数据一致性问题,由于缓存数据与数据库数据存在一定时间的同步延迟,可能会导致缓存中的数据与数据库中的实时数据不一致,为了解决这一问题,可以采用数据过期策略、主动刷新机制以及分布式事务处理技术等方法,确保缓存数据的最终一致性,缓存服务器本身的安全问题也不容忽视,缓存服务器存储了大量敏感的业务数据,一旦遭受攻击或数据泄露,将对企业和用户造成严重损失,需要加强缓存服务器的访问控制、数据加密以及安全防护措施,如设置防火墙、入侵检测系统等,保障数据的安全性和隐私性。

高性能缓存服务器作为现代信息技术架构中不可或缺的一部分,以其卓越的性能优势在各个领域发挥着重要作用,随着技术的不断发展和创新,未来高性能缓存服务器将在智能化缓存策略、更高效的数据压缩算法以及与其他新兴技术如人工智能、边缘计算的深度融合等方面取得更大的突破和进展,为推动各行业的数字化转型和业务发展提供更强大的动力支持。

排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1